David A. Entwistle
About
David A. Entwistle has authored 30 papers that have received a total of 1.3k indexed citations.
This includes 21 papers in Organic Chemistry, 16 papers in Molecular Biology and 3 papers in Biomedical Engineering. The topics of these papers are Enzyme Immobilization Techniques (11 papers), Carbohydrate Chemistry and Synthesis (8 papers) and Chemical Synthesis and Analysis (5 papers). David A. Entwistle is often cited by papers focused on Enzyme Immobilization Techniques (11 papers), Carbohydrate Chemistry and Synthesis (8 papers) and Chemical Synthesis and Analysis (5 papers) and collaborates with scholars based in United Kingdom, United States and Switzerland. David A. Entwistle's co-authors include Steven V. Ley, Philip Lenden, Andrew Thorpe, Michael C. Willis and Oscar Alvizo and has published in prestigious journals such as Chemical Reviews, JAMA and Angewandte Chemie International Edition.
